本文目录导读:
在数字化时代,后端服务器开发工程师作为企业技术团队的核心力量,肩负着构建高效、稳定、安全的数字基础设施的重任,他们通过精湛的技术手段,将抽象的业务需求转化为实际的可执行代码,为用户提供优质的在线服务,本文将详细阐述后端服务器开发工程师的岗位职责,以期帮助广大求职者和企业更好地了解这一岗位。
岗位职责
1、技术研发与实现
后端服务器开发工程师需根据项目需求,运用多种编程语言和框架,如Java、Python、Go等,进行技术选型,他们需要设计并实现系统架构,确保系统的可扩展性、高性能和稳定性,具体职责包括:
(1)参与需求分析,与产品经理、前端工程师等沟通,明确业务逻辑和功能需求;
图片来源于网络,如有侵权联系删除
(2)设计系统架构,包括数据库设计、接口设计、API文档编写等;
(3)编写代码,实现业务逻辑和功能需求;
(4)进行单元测试和集成测试,确保代码质量;
(5)持续优化代码,提高系统性能和可维护性。
2、系统运维与监控
后端服务器开发工程师需关注系统运行状态,确保系统稳定运行,具体职责包括:
(1)部署和维护服务器,包括操作系统、数据库、中间件等;
(2)监控系统运行状态,及时发现并处理异常情况;
(3)进行系统优化,提高系统性能和可用性;
(4)编写运维文档,为其他运维人员提供参考。
3、团队协作与沟通
后端服务器开发工程师需与团队成员保持良好的沟通,共同推进项目进度,具体职责包括:
图片来源于网络,如有侵权联系删除
(1)与前端工程师、产品经理、测试人员等保持密切沟通,确保需求理解和实现的一致性;
(2)参与团队技术分享,提升团队整体技术水平;
(3)协助其他成员解决技术问题,共同提高项目质量。
4、技术支持与培训
后端服务器开发工程师需为其他团队成员提供技术支持,确保项目顺利进行,具体职责包括:
(1)解答团队成员在技术方面的疑问,提供技术指导;
(2)组织技术培训,提升团队成员的技术能力;
(3)关注行业动态,将新技术、新方法引入项目实践。
5、安全保障
后端服务器开发工程师需关注系统安全,确保用户数据安全,具体职责包括:
(1)参与安全架构设计,提高系统安全性;
(2)编写安全相关的代码,防范潜在的安全风险;
图片来源于网络,如有侵权联系删除
(3)对系统进行安全测试,及时发现并修复安全漏洞;
(4)关注安全政策法规,确保项目符合相关要求。
任职要求
1、教育背景:计算机相关专业本科及以上学历;
2、技术能力:熟练掌握至少一种编程语言,如Java、Python、Go等;了解常用数据库、中间件等技术;
3、项目经验:具备实际项目开发经验,熟悉项目开发流程和规范;
4、团队协作:具备良好的沟通能力,能够与团队成员高效协作;
5、学习能力:具备较强的学习能力,能够快速掌握新技术、新方法;
6、职业素养:具备良好的职业操守,对工作认真负责。
后端服务器开发工程师作为企业技术团队的核心力量,承担着构建高效、稳定、安全的数字基础设施的重任,他们通过精湛的技术手段,为企业提供优质的服务,推动企业数字化转型,了解后端服务器开发工程师的岗位职责,有助于求职者更好地定位自己的职业发展方向,为企业选拔合适的人才。
标签: #后端服务器开发工程师岗位职责
评论列表